Output 52e61ec2594de4927f28168da2b878cda72269e02eb8533ad4d60446a9dfff0f:1

value
8083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f2c81cf84b9d134f5509b257758e36359559dba OP_EQUAL
address
3Ek3sP4NpSeAhS6v43pdvS9bE5RmDXrbTV
transaction
52e61ec2594de4927f28168da2b878cda72269e02eb8533ad4d60446a9dfff0f
confirmations
200238
spent
true